Method
Prepare the Patties
- In a mixing bowl, combine ground beef, salt, black pepper, garlic powder, and onion powder. Mix gently until just combined.
- Divide the mixture into 4 equal portions and shape them into patties, making a slight indentation in the center of each patty.
Grill the Burgers
- Preheat the grill to medium-high heat.
- Place the patties on the grill and cook for about 4-5 minutes on one side.
- Flip the patties, add a slice of cheese on top, and cook for another 4-5 minutes or until the internal temperature reaches 160°F (71°C).
Assemble the Burgers
- Toast the burger buns on the grill for about 1 minute.
- Spread mayonnaise on the bottom bun, then add the lettuce, patty with melted cheese, tomato slices, pickles, and any additional condiments.
- Top with the other half of the bun and serve immediately.
